some specific things: a lot of tris on the furnace or on a sign that should just be a texture tbh.
the cut mattress is wild at almost 300k tri's. suitcases closely followed with 299k and the backpack at like 160k. A lot of this should just be a normal map. And some of them need a custom model.
Though the mattresses are quite bad, they're seldom around so i think they're low prio.
Especially on older hardware or on dx11 this can be an extreme performance hit.
